The previous approach (custom CMD on gitea-app) failed because:
- Gitea's entrypoint generates app.ini as root, then drops to git user
- Overriding CMD ran our script before app.ini was generated
- su-exec to git user lost access to the entrypoint-generated config
Now uses the same pattern as nocodb-init: a separate container that
depends on gitea-app being healthy, shares the gitea-data volume
(which has app.ini), and runs gitea admin user create.

The Gitea Docker entrypoint sets up directories as root then exec's
the CMD still as root. Gitea refuses to run as root, so our init
script must re-exec itself as the 'git' user via su-exec before
running any gitea commands.
